How to fill out working with impact assessment:

01
Start by gathering all relevant information and data related to the project or program you are assessing. This could include project plans, objectives, timelines, and any previous impact assessments conducted.
02
Review the purpose and scope of the impact assessment to understand the goals and objectives it is trying to achieve. This will help guide your data collection and analysis.
03
Identify the key stakeholders and determine their interests, concerns, and involvement in the project. This could include both internal and external stakeholders such as employees, clients, regulatory bodies, and local communities.
04
Use appropriate methods to collect data and assess the potential impacts of the project. This could involve conducting interviews, surveys, site visits, and reviewing relevant documents.
05
Analyze the collected data to identify potential positive and negative impacts of the project. Consider both short-term and long-term impacts on various aspects such as social, economic, environmental, and cultural factors.
06
Evaluate the significance of each impact by considering the scale, duration, reversibility, and likelihood of occurrence. This will help prioritize and focus on the most important impacts.
07
Develop strategies and mitigation measures to minimize the negative impacts and enhance the positive ones. These could include changes in project design, implementation approaches, or stakeholder engagement methods.
08
Document your findings and recommendations in a clear and comprehensive report. Include a summary of the assessment process, key findings, identified impacts, proposed mitigations, and any additional considerations.
09
Share the assessment report with relevant stakeholders and seek their feedback and input. This will ensure transparency, accountability, and inclusiveness in the decision-making process.
10
Continuously monitor and evaluate the project's impacts throughout its lifecycle. Adjust and improve the mitigation measures as needed to achieve the desired outcomes.
